    Struggling to find effective ELD lesson plans for upper elementary students? You’re not alone. Many teachers—myself included—find that Designated English Language Development (ELD) programs built into reading curriculum lack engagement, structure, and oral language opportunities. These ELD lessons often fall short of filling the required 30-minute instructional block and don’t provide the speaking practice English […]
